When you first start your diet one of several things you will learn right away is that maintaining a food journal is very helpful. Tracking all of the meals you take in can help you figure out which foods you will be eating as well as which foods you are not eating enough of. For example, after retaining a food journal for a few days, you might see that you are not taking in very many vegetables but that you are consuming lots of sugar and bad carbohydrates. When you write every little thing down youll be able to see which parts of your diet must change as well as have a lot easier time figuring out what kind and how long of a workout you need to do to shrink your waist line and burn the most calories.

Be as precise as you can when you write down what you eat. You should do more than simply write down "salad" into your food journal. You should record each of the ingredients within that salad as well as the type of dressing on it. You also need to record just how much of the foods you are eating. Cereal is just not as beneficial an entry as one cup Honey Nut Cheerios. Dont forget that the more of something you take in, the more calories you are going to take in so you need to list out the measurements of what you eat so that you will know exactly how many calories you take in and will need to burn.

Write down your feelings whenever you eat. This helps you to demonstrate whether or not you decide on food as a reaction to emotional issues. It also assists you to see clearly which foods you are inclined to choose when you find yourself in certain moods. Many people will reach for junk foods if we are worried, angry or depressed and will be more likely to choose healthier options when we are happy or content. When you focus on how you eat during your different moods and emotional states, you will be able to keep similar but healthier alternatives around for when you need those snacks--you might also start talking to someone who can help you figure out why you try to cure your moods with food.

The ingredients needed to prepare Honey Curry Chicken Thighs:

  1. Take 8 of chicken thighs.
  2. You need 1/2 cup of Honey.
  3. Get 1/2 tbsp of Curry Powder.
  4. Use 3/4 cup of Soy Sauce.
  5. Use 1/4 tbsp of Salt.
  6. Provide 1/4 tbsp of Black Pepper.
  7. Prepare 1/2 tbsp of Garlic Powder.
  8. Provide can of cooking spray.

Steps to make Honey Curry Chicken Thighs:

  1. Mix together soy sauce, salt, pepper, garlic powder and only ONE HALF of the tablespoon of curry powder in a bowl. Mix until well blended..
  2. Place chicken in bowl or zip loc bag with mixture to marinade overnight or for at least 4 hours in refrigerator..
  3. After the allotted time, remove chicken from fridge and spray 9x13 pan with cooking spray..
  4. Remove chicken pieces from marinade and place in baking pan..
  5. Bake chicken at 350 for 45 minutes covered. While baking, mix the remaining curry powder and honey together..
  6. Microwave honey mixture 30 seconds for a more fluid consistency..
  7. After 45 minutes of baking uncover chicken and glaze chicken with honey mixture generously. Broil at 500 for 5 minutes or until chicken has turned golden brown..
  8. Once chicken is removed from oven you may sprinkle fresh or dried parsley on top for color and added flavor..
  9. ENJOY!.
